Hello house, kindly help me in reviewing my transcript. I have posted it somedays ago but the few people who reviewed it said my responses to the questions are so long. So I have made adjustments to my responses.
P.S: My interview is tomorrow, I will need all the whole help I can get from you all. Thank you.
We graduated from the same university and now same university for masters.. I wish you all the best..

ME: Good morning Sir/Ma


CONSULAR: Good morning

CONSULAR: Pass me Your Passport and i-20
ME: Okay Sir/Ma (passes it)

CONSULAR: Why Are You Going to the US?
ME: I am going to the US to study for my Master’s in Econometrics and Quantitative Economics at the Western Illinois University, Macomb.

CONSULAR: How did you get the school/how did you hear about this school?
ME: After coming across a research paper written by Professor Shankar Ghimire which was very useful to me during an undergraduate study, I grew interested in the scope and works of Professor Ghimire. Furthermore, I complemented Professor Ghimire on the excellent knowledge he shared in his research paper and I also informed him of my strong desire in having a graduate degree in an analytical field of Economics. Professor Ghimire who happens to be the program advisor of the quantitative economics program at the Western Illinois University informed me of the scientific economics program they run that would fit my description. Upon Professor Ghimire recommendation of the Western Illinois University, I carried out an extensive personal research on this school by making use of search engines such as 4icu, US News, The Grad Café, and I was better informed and at the same time convinced with the high analytical program offered by the western Illinois university that perfectly meets my academic desire.

CONSULAR: How Many Schools Did You Apply To, how many gave you admission and name them?
ME: I applied to 4 Universities, and all 4 gave me an admission. They are; Western Illinois University, University of Colorado Boulder, Rowan University, and Youngstown State University.

CONSULAR: Why did you pick this school/ why Western Illinois University?
ME: WIU shifted from the traditional economics coursework which comprises of Economic theories but rather emphasizes on data analysis, data optimization, and data interpretation as courses to be undertaken in the program. This would give me a more practical and scientific approach to my career as a financial analyst. Furthermore the quantitative economics program of the western Illinois University is classified as a stem degree as opposed to others which are non-stem. This would expose me to unlimited researches and scientific analysis which is an essential tool to my career growth.

CONSULAR: What is this course about?
ME: Econometrics and quantitative economics is a branch of economics that focuses on the systematic study of how to make use of mathematics, statistics and data analysis to analyze economic phenomenon and problems in a scientific manner with the aim of providing practical and scientific solutions. E.Q.E is a field of economics that depicts and explains economic theories using mathematical models, statistical diagram, and data analytics.

CONSULAR: Why Do You need this Masters/what will this degree do for you?
ME: The Quantitative Economics degree will provide me with the analytical skills needed to achieve my short term career objective as a Financial Analyst at the Federal Ministry of Finance, Nigeria. In this position, this degree will provide me with the expertise needed for analyzing financial situation. Furthermore this degree will provide with the knowledge needed to manage data effectively for business decision. On the long run, I plan on becoming a financial consultant and advisor to the Federal and State Government of Nigeria.

CONSULAR: Tell Me About Your Academic Background?
ME: I graduated from the Osun State University in 2019 with a Bachelor’s degree in Economics and a Second Class Upper grade. As an undergraduate, I was an active student in the research department of my undergraduate institution in which I was involved with carrying out researches and analyzing related data. I am competent in the mathematical analysis of economic phenomenal, and I am also experienced in data analysis. Due to my selfless act, I organized tutorials and tutor my colleagues and junior students on various economics courses.

CONSULAR: What Have You Been Doing since you graduated?
ME: After graduating from college in 2019, I undertook the compulsory Nigerian Youth service scheme. In this scheme I was deployed to the Lagos State Ministry of Economic Planning and Budget, where I contributed to sourcing for development partners’ ready to collaborate with the Lagos state government on various developmental issues, I also attended stakeholder meetings where deliberations were made on the review and Implementation of the Yearly Lagos state government budget. After a successful completion of this scheme, I got a job as a Financial Analyst Trainee at *****. In this position I am being trained on analyzing various financial trends, providing statistical analysis for various financial decisions, and researching on business opportunities and threats.

CONSULAR: What are those courses you’ll be taking/ Tell me about your program?
ME: I will be taking 6 core courses and 3 elective courses. Some of the core courses are; Macroeconomic Theory and Policy by Professor Ghimire, Price Theory by Professor Lin, Econometrics 1 by Professor Kassing, Statistical Software for Data Management and Decision Making by Professor Jessica. The elective courses are; Thesis Research and Thesis in which a supervisor will provided to me upon decision of the departmental graduate faculty.

CONSULAR: What are your Study plans?
ME: I will be taking a total of 30 semester hour coursework, which comprises of 6 core courses and 3 elective courses namely; Macroeconomic Theory and Policy, Econometrics 1, Price Theory, Econometrics 2, Advanced Mathematical Economics, Statistical Software for Data Management and Decision Making, big data for business decision making, advanced data mining for business. I am expected to complete my program on the 12th of May, 2023. Upon completion of my program, my immediate plan is to return back to Nigeria to work has a full time Financial Analyst. In this position I will make contributions to the government’s financial policy, carry out research on viable project for the government, and I will provide statistical recommendations for various financial policy.

CONSULAR: Did You Write Any Standardized Test?
ME: Yes, I took the GRE test, with a total score of 300.

CONSULAR: Are you married?
ME: No, I am not married.

CONSULAR: Have You Travelled Before?
ME: No I haven’t had a reason to travel out of the country.

CONSULAR: Who Is Paying For This? / Who Is Sponsoring You?
ME: My mother is my sponsor. She is a successful business woman in the Nigerian hospitality industry. She specializes as an Hotelier owning three 4-Star Hotels, 1 home appliances Supermarket, and 1 large consumer-product retail store in Lagos state, Ogun state, and Oyo state. In addition to that I received an international commitment scholarship in the sum of $4000 due to my impressive undergraduate academic achievements which would be covering a portion of my tuition

CONSULAR: What do you do presently?
ME: I am currently employed as a financial analyst trainee at *****, a Private Firm rendering financial and accounting services, where I am gaining experience which will prepare me for my Masters in Quantitative Economics. In this position I analyze financial instrument, examine various financial decisions made by our clients, prepare statistical model to aid the firm’s senior management decision, and I carry out SWOT analysis for various client, amongst other functions.

CONSULAR: What are your career plans / what is your plan after graduation/ what will this degree do for you?
ME: upon completion of my program, this degree and the experiences I would be gaining will move me higher in my career ladder to the position of a full time financial analyst. My immediate plan is to return back to Nigeria to work as a Financial Risk Analyst specifically at the Federal Ministry of Finance, Nigeria. In this position I will work in the capacity of a consultant rendering financial risk analysis to selected private institutions in the Financial Industry. My medium term plan is to work as an Investment Analyst at the Nigerian Sovereign Investment Authority. In this position, I will analyze the investment decision of the federal government, and give necessary recommendation on the most profitable and viable investments. My inevitable long term plan is to establish a financial consulting firm, rendering advisory and consultation services to the public and private sector.

Transcript
Glory to God
Status: Approved
Embassy: Lagos Consulate
Date: 9th June, 2021
Time: 7:30am
COA: $32k
Funding: 20% off Tuition (Dean's scholarship)

P:S- I gave birth to both my kids in the US so I have two US citizen kids but no question was asked about that


I went through all the biometrics and all and eventually got in Interviewed at 8:40am

VO: Good morning
Me: Good morning
VO: Pass me your Passport and i20 please
VO: Where are you going?
Me: University of New Haven, Connecticut for my Master degree program in Criminal Justice
VO: What do you do?
Me: I am a paramilitary officer, I work in Bleep and I currently serve in the Intelligence and Criminal Investigations Department of the Corp.
VO: (types for long then turned to me) Where did you say you work?
Me: I work at Bleep
VO types for long again
VO: Who is going to sponsor your program?
Me: My mother. She deals in the wholesale supply of textile materials to retailers and she is also in partnership with the Federal government of Nigeria to supply textile materials used to make uniforms for Bleep and she also has access to funds from my late father's estate.
VO: She has access to funds from where?
Me: My late Father's estate.
VO: Do you have her bank statement?
Me: Yes and I passed it to him.
He checks the first page and flips to the last page then returns it.
Types for long again and said he will approve my visa.....

So many people were denied, there were more denials but I just thank God. Some people actually crammed their transcript and it worked against them. Try not to sound like you crammed anything, just let it come naturally.

Re: General USA Student Visa Enquiries-part 16 by TWoods(m): 2:28am On Jun 10, 2021
Tshendy:
Good evening all.
Please my wife interview F2 visa interview is coming up this month but we have issue with her name

The name on her passport is her maiden name and that was what was used to prepare her I-20. But she has done change of name and she filled her new name on ds-160. Please I hope this will not cause any problem.

I mailed the international office to change her name to her new name but they said the policy is that they should use only verified names and names are verified through passport.

Please what do you think we should do

Passport, I-20 and DS-160 forms are all immigration documents, you absolutely need to maintain the same name across all three to avoid unnecessary hassle. The easiest thing would be to fill out another DS-160 form and use her maiden name all through.

Re: General USA Student Visa Enquiries-part 16 by Tayoade19: 10:23am On Jun 10, 2021
Shadomaan7:
Hello All,

I did my visa interview today at the Lagos embassy and was denied. The reason was because the VO said there is no proof that I got a tuition waiver from my school but I showed her where it was written on the I-20 but she said it’s not enough proof. I attack the I-20 screenshot below.

Transcript
VO: Good Morning. Pass me your I-20 and passport.
VO: Why are you going to the USA
Me: I’m going to the USA for my masters in Industrial Engineering at LSU
VO: Why LSU
Me: After I completed my GRE exam, I went online to look for universities that offer admission for Ms in industrial engineering and LSU was part of the universities that came up in the search. I emailed the departmental coordinator with my credentials and she gave a promising reply and went far as saying I can merit a tuition waiver from the graduate school with my credentials which I was later awarded.

—That is where the problem started, the VO said she can’t see any tuition waiver award on my I-20 but I told her it’s right there under the remarks with a ** and she said no.

Then I brought out a printout of the email from the graduate school where they gave the tuition waiver award and she said that is still not enough evidence and she will be denying my visa.

Normally total cost of attendance is $47,600 but with my tuition waiver it’s $22100. But yet this VO is not taking it.

Please help me guys, I am trying to reapply, could you please advise on what need to be done?

I just emailed the department coordinator, graduate school, and ISO office to notify them about this and request an official letter of the tuition waiver award but no reply yet coz I think it’s still very early in USA.

Please advise on what I can do about this.

Also:
What process do I need to take to reapply for my visa? Do I need to fill in another DS-160? Could some help with a high level view of how I need to reapply for appointment because I am trying to reapply today ASAP to get a date sooner.



Truly, a critical look at the screenshot of your i20 shows nothing about the funding/tuition waiver. You will need the school to prepare another i20 for you which will show that the COA=$47600 and *funding from school/tuition waiver=$22100*, family fund=$25500.
Without the asterisked part spelt out on your i20, the VO will not believe your story and the proof from your email. The school should give the proper breakdown on your i20, if truly you have the tuition waiver.
